Dismissed -continuing on?

Does anyone know of a situation where a SRNA was dismissed from their anesthesia program for 'nebulous' clinical reasons and was successful at getting admitted to another CRNA program? Is there a precedent anywhere on this?

Thank you for any information on this topic

'Nebulous clinical reason' - well without spilling your guts a little background would be helpful. But from what I've seen its extremely difficult if not impossible to get into another program after being dismissed for not preforming clinically or not not maintaining the appropriate grades. I'm sure there will be someone who will tell me I'm wrong, and while there are always exceptions. I think generally, the answer is very difficult. Good Luck.
